My most recent try? L’Oreal Bare Naturale Luminous Lengthening Mascara in Black.

L’Oreal Bare Naturale Luminous Lengthening Mascara is hypoallergenic and is available in three colors: Blackest Black, Black, and Black Brown. The product is formulated with natural ingredients like jojoba oil, Vitamin E and aloe. There is currently no waterproof version/formula being sold.

Priced at about $7-$9 dollars depending on the store you buy it from, it’s a little pricier in comparison to the average drugstore mascara. It promises to lengthen your lashes and to separate them to create a nice, natural look. And you know what? It does exactly what it says it would do. One coast did lengthen and separate my stubby lashes without making them too stiff. It is very buildable and I experienced minimal clumping, if any at all.  Great, right?

But of course, it isn’t the perfect mascara. While it did lengthen and separate my lashes well, this mascara does not do much to thicken your lashes (the ads don’t really promise that, but still… I look for it!). It also didn’t hold the curl of my eyelashes very well, which really disappointed me because I love curling my eyelashes. The formula is also thinner than most and it takes a little while to dry do you have to be careful about that too! Like most mascaras, smearing and flaking happens, but it didn’t happen for at least 10 hours with this mascara.

Finally:
This product is available at drugstores and chain stores such as Target and Wal-Mart for about $7-$9 dollars.
Pros: lengthening, minimal clumping, affordable, delivers what it promises
Cons: no waterproof variations, takes a while to dry, pricey for a drugstore mascara

I give this mascara an overall rating of 3.5 our 5.
